sofa
SOH-fuh
noun
1
A long upholstered seat with a back and arms, meant for two or more people.
"They spent the evening curled up on the sofa watching movies."

UK vs US
British English favors "sofa"; American English often says "couch," though both are widely understood.

Etymology
Borrowed from French sofa, ultimately from Arabic ṣuffa, a raised, carpeted stone seat.
